Creating The Cosplay Armor: An Detailed Guide
Embarking on the process of creating your own cosplay armor can seem intimidating at first, but with this guide, you’ll be well on your way to building impressive pieces. Initially, you'll need some 3D device, CADModeling plastic (typically PLA or ABS), and modeling software. Next, locate or create your armor patterns online – there are choices available. Afterward, convert the models into machine-understandable instructions. Thoroughly fabricate each section, paying attention to build height and infill. Once creation is complete, remove any attachments and finish the surface with putty and polishing methods. Ultimately, paint your armor with a desired colors and protect it with a varnish for a professional look.
